RR's aren't all bad:

Quote:
Originally Posted by Andreas Miko
It about right for a roller rocker motor. RR motors make more stock HP than any other SR20DE. The standard DE willl make 296 WHP at 12 PSI with S4 cams. His RR motor with the JWT RR cams will make the same 296 at about 11 PSI not 12 like a DE.

The reason is the RR is more efficient because of the 4 counterweigh crank and the roller rocker design in the head, less hp loss due to less friction.

1) Engine Number: 2J2...
2) 1996 200sx se-r
3) Yes, the engine was swapped.
4) USDM(?)
5) No. 96 ecu worked fine. However, programmed it with JWT for turbo application.
6) No mods were done to the engine internally. GT28RS kit was slapped on after the swap. SOKO unexpectedly sent a RR motor. (I am fine with that, just have to watch my boost and lots of retarding to save any detonation, none so far).
7) PM here is fastest way to contact via internet

I like the sound and fast revving capability of this motor better than my previous usdm 93, 97 and jdm 91 motor. I do not like the 7100 or so limit. I had mine locked at 7100 so I never touch 7500 limit or more. (better safe than sorry as this is a daily driver)
